Home
last modified time | relevance | path

Searched refs:ParsingClass (Results 1 – 4 of 4) sorted by relevance

/external/clang/include/clang/Parse/
DParser.h865 struct ParsingClass;
889 LateParsedClass(Parser *P, ParsingClass *C);
899 ParsingClass *Class;
1036 struct ParsingClass { struct
1037 ParsingClass(Decl *TagOrTemplate, bool TopLevelClass, bool IsInterface) in ParsingClass() argument
1065 std::stack<ParsingClass *> ClassStack; argument
1067 ParsingClass &getCurrentClass() { in getCurrentClass()
1156 void DeallocateParsedClasses(ParsingClass *Class);
1171 void ParseLexedAttributes(ParsingClass &Class);
1176 void ParseLexedMethodDeclarations(ParsingClass &Class);
[all …]
/external/clang/lib/Parse/
DParseCXXInlineMethods.cpp235 Parser::LateParsedClass::LateParsedClass(Parser *P, ParsingClass *C) in LateParsedClass()
270 void Parser::ParseLexedMethodDeclarations(ParsingClass &Class) { in ParseLexedMethodDeclarations()
473 void Parser::ParseLexedMethodDefs(ParsingClass &Class) { in ParseLexedMethodDefs()
576 void Parser::ParseLexedMemberInitializers(ParsingClass &Class) { in ParseLexedMemberInitializers()
DParseDeclCXX.cpp3448 ClassStack.push(new ParsingClass(ClassDecl, NonNestedClass, IsInterface)); in PushParsingClass()
3454 void Parser::DeallocateParsedClasses(Parser::ParsingClass *Class) { in DeallocateParsedClasses()
3471 ParsingClass *Victim = ClassStack.top(); in PopParsingClass()
DParseDecl.cpp1097 void Parser::ParseLexedAttributes(ParsingClass &Class) { in ParseLexedAttributes()